Eureka B&B receives hospitality honor

Sunday, June 3, 2012

Special to Carroll County News

EUREKA SPRINGS -- Bridgeford House Bed and Breakfast has announced that it has received a TripAdvisor Certificate of Excellence award.

The accolade, which honors hospitality excellence, is given only to establishments that consistently achieve outstanding traveler reviews on TripAdvisor, and is extended to qualifying businesses worldwide. Approximately 10 percent of accommodations listed on TripAdvisor receive this prestigious award.

To qualify for the Certificate of Excellence, businesses must maintain an overall rating of four or higher, out of a possible five, as reviewed by travelers on TripAdvisor. Additional criteria include the volume of reviews received within the last 12 months.

"Bridgeford House is pleased to receive a TripAdvisor Certificate of Excellence," said Sam Feldman, one of the owners of the inn, along with her husband, Jeff. "We strive to offer our customers a memorable experience, and this accolade is evidence that our hard work is translating into positive traveler reviews on TripAdvisor."

"TripAdvisor is pleased to honor exceptional businesses for consistent excellence, as reviewed by travelers on the site," said Christine Petersen, president of TripAdvisor for Business. "The Certificate of Excellence award gives highly rated establishments around the world the recognition they deserve. From exceptional accommodations in Beijing to remarkable restaurants in Boston, we want to applaud these businesses for offering TripAdvisor travelers a great customer experience."

The 1884 Bridgeford House Bed & Breakfast is a 5-room Queen Anne Eastlake Victorian inn located in the "silk stocking district" of Eureka Springs, right on the Historic Loop, within a walking distance to shops, galleries, spas and restaurants
